# Product Feedback

## What it does

Product Feedback gives you a direct line to the sideBar team from inside the
app. When you report a bug or request a feature in Chat, sideBar files a
report automatically and sends you a link to the issue so you can track it.
No need to leave the app, find a support email, or fill out a form.

## Actions

| Action                   | Description                                                                 |
| ------------------------ | --------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| File a bug report        | Logs the issue with the sideBar team and returns a link so you can track it |
| Submit a feature request | Records your idea and returns a link to the issue                           |

## When sideBar uses it

When you describe a bug or request a feature in conversation. You don't need
any special phrasing, just tell sideBar naturally:

* "I found a bug with X"
* "I'd love a feature that does Y"
* "Something isn't working right when I Z"

sideBar recognises when you're giving feedback and handles the rest.

## Requirements

* **Tier:** Required (always active, cannot be disabled)
* **API key:** None required

## Examples

> "I found a bug. When I archive a note it sometimes reappears in my list."

> "Could you add the ability to sort tasks by priority?"

> "The app crashed when I tried to attach a file to a message."
